Urgent Appeal to Find Missing Teenager from Sevenoaks

 

Kent Police are appealing for the public’s help to locate Jay Barton, a 19-year-old teenager who has been reported missing from Sevenoaks.

Last Seen in Otford

Jay was last seen at around 10 am on Tuesday, April 1, 2025, in the Pilgrims Way area of Otford, near Sevenoaks. Police and his family are growing increasingly concerned for his welfare.

Description

Jay Barton is described as:

  • Approximately 6ft tall
  • Dark brown, shoulder-length hair
  • Stubble on his face
  • Wearing grey jogging bottoms, a black t-shirt, black Nike trainers with the laces undone, and a black waterproof coat
  • He may also be carrying a grey backpack with blue lining
